Taras Vladimirovich Kulakov (Russian: Тарас Владимирович Кулакoв;[1] Ukrainian: Тарас Володимирович Кулаков; born March 11, 1987), better known as CrazyRussianHacker, is an American YouTuber.[4][5]
He became known for his content on life hacks, technology, and scientific demonstrations,[6] popularized with the catchphrase "Safety is [the] number one priority" at the beginning of most of his videos.[7]
Kulakov's presence on YouTube is split between three channels, as of June 2023[update]: "CrazyRussianHacker," created in 2012, has over three billion views and 11.8 million subscribers, and is one of the platform's top 500 channels;[8] "Taras Kul," created in 2009, has over 3.6 million subscribers; "Kul Farm," created in 2014, has 353,000 subscribers.
